About the Organization For over 70 years, The Arc Northern Chesapeake Region has helped people with intellectual and developmental disabilities build better lives one person at a time. We provide support services and advocacy to 400 adults and children and their families in Harford and Cecil Counties. The Arc supports people with intellectual and developmental disabilities to create lives that mirror yours and mine: students attending neighborhood schools, adults going to work and living in their own homes, and individuals enjoying the social and recreational opportunities in their communities. We are a private, non-profit local chapter of The Arc of Maryland and The Arc of The United States, the largest volunteer organization in the world devoted exclusively to improving the quality of life for all adults and children with developmental disabilities.

Summary

The goal of the Treatment Foster Care Program at The Arc Northern Chesapeake Region (NCR) is to provide for the safety, permanence and wellbeing of children in Out-of-Home care within Harford, Cecil and Northern Harford Counties. Treatment Foster Volunteers/Parents play a vital role in this process. Under the supervision of the Clinical Social Worker, the Treatment Foster Care Volunteer/Parents are responsible for the day-to-day and specialized care needs of a child or children placed in the Specialist's home as defined in each child's Individual Treatment Plan.



Essential Functions




  • Maintain compliance with all required training and provide all required documentation to The Arc NCR;

  • Assist the Clinical Social Worker and other team members in the development of treatment plans for a child or youth in their care;

  • Attend team meetings and training sessions;

  • Keep a systematic record of a child's behavior and progress in targeted areas and submit foster parent logs on a weekly basis;

  • Ensure a child access to medical and dental care, including accompanying the child to medical and dental appointments and carrying out treatment prescribed by health care providers;

  • Coordinate recreational and leisure time activity;

  • Monitor a child's school attendance and progress, and attend parental conferences and activities;

  • Provide transportation services;

  • Maintain a medical passport;

  • Attend and provide information at court hearings as specified in the treatment plan; and

  • Assist a child in maintaining contact and visitation with the child's biological family unless otherwise indicated in the child's treatment plan.



*All necessary training and certifications will be provided to the volunteer free of charge.



**This is a volunteer position. There is payment for supporting a foster child but it is to be used towards the day-to-day needs of the foster child.
